About The Position

AdvanceCare Health Services, LLC is seeking a Part-Time Contract Waiver/DDA Program Consultant to review programmatic work and ensure compliance with Tennessee state standards for ECF, DDA, and CLS Waiver Services. The consultant will also assist with necessary corrections. This is a work-from-home position requiring 10 to 15 hours per week. Applicants must reside in Tennessee and possess experience with Tennessee Department of Disability and Aging programs. Essential requirements include high-speed internet and a specific home office setup (27" or larger monitor, mouse, keyboard for use with a company laptop). Consistent availability for the specified hours is crucial, and the role must not conflict with or be performed during primary employment duties. The company is a growing non-medical, private duty home care organization providing services to seniors and support to individuals with intellectual disabilities across Tennessee.
